What are the most common mistakes to avoid during a home renovation?

Home renovations can be rewarding but often come with challenges. Common mistakes include:

  • Neglecting a budget: Failing to set a realistic budget can lead to overspending and financial strain.
  • Inadequate planning: Not having a clear plan can result in delays and unexpected costs.
  • Ignoring permits: Skipping necessary permits can lead to legal issues and fines.
  • Choosing the wrong contractor: Hiring an unqualified contractor can compromise quality and safety.
  • Overlooking timelines: Underestimating the time required for renovations can disrupt daily life.
  • Compromising on quality: Opting for cheaper materials may save money initially but can lead to higher costs in the long run due to repairs.

Avoiding these mistakes requires careful planning, research, and communication with professionals to ensure a successful renovation project.
